Abstract

L'invention concerne des compositions comprenant un mélange de: (1) un polymère vinylamidique, hydrosoluble, ionique, contenant suffisamment de vinylamide et de substituants -CHOHCHO pour être thermodurcissable ainsi que des substituants du type glyoxal et des substituants réagissant aux substituants du type glyoxal selon un rapport dépassant environ 0,02:1,0, et (2) un polymère vinylamidique, hydrosoluble, cationique, glyoxalaté, d'un poids moléculaire d'environ 500 à environ 6000, contenant suffisamment de substituants réagissant aux substituants du type glyoxal et de substituants du type glyoxal pour être thermodurcissable, le rapport des substituants du type glyoxal aux substituants vinylamides dépassant environ 0,1:1,0.
